    What you do:

    1. Login to Paypal
    2. Click on "Details" for the specific transaction
    3. Scroll to the very bottom where it says "Have a problem? Address a problem with this transaction in the Resolution Center." and click the link to the Resolution Center.
    4. Select "Item Dispute", then click "Continue". Follow the remaining instructions to start a dispute with Paypal. They will freeze the money in his account until the dispute is resolved (99% of the time you can get your money back).
    5. Give bad itrader rating here and be sure to put "Scammer" or something in the comment.
    6. Be thankful that it was a small amount of money.
